			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>The administrator of this blog recently came across a press release from the United States Mission in India. The following is <a title="quoted" href="http://www.aila.org/content/default.aspx?docid=33670" target="_blank">quoted</a> directly from the press release as distributed by the American Immigration Lawyers Association (AILA):</p>
<blockquote><p><strong><em>New Delhi &#8211; In an effort to make the visa application process more convenient for all Indians, the U.S. Embassy in New Delhi and Consulates General in Mumbai, Chennai, Kolkata and Hyderabad now accept visa applications from across India at all visa facilities, regardless of the applicant’s home address or city of residence. This is part of Mission India’s ongoing effort to facilitate legitimate travel to the United States.</em></strong></p>
<p><strong><em>Following the opening of Consulate General Hyderabad in 2008, the U.S. Mission has looked for ways to best capture the dynamism of India’s growth across the nation. As a result, we also redesigned our consular districts. Therefore, effective immediately, our consular districts will be reorganized as follows: Embassy Delhi: Bihar, Delhi, Haryana, Himachal Pradesh, Jammu and Kashmir, Punjab, Rajasthan, Uttarakhand, Uttar Pradesh, Bhutan; Consulate Mumbai: Goa, Gujarat, Madhya Pradesh, Maharashtra, Diu and Daman, and Dadra and Nagar Haveli; Consulate Hyderabad: Andhra Pradesh, Orissa; Consulate Chennai: Karnataka, Kerala, Puducherry, Lakshadweep, Tamil Nadu, Andaman and Nicobar Islands; Consulate Kolkata: Arunachal Pradesh, Assam, Chhattisgarh, Jharkhand, Manipur, Meghalaya, Mizoram, Nagaland, Sikkim, Tripura, West Bengal</em></strong></p>
<p><strong><em>U.S. Ambassador to India Timothy J. Roemer said, “With these changes, we believe our Consulates General and our Embassy in New Delhi will be even better positioned to support and serve Indian visa applicants, as well as American citizens and businesses throughout India.”</em></strong></p></blockquote>
<p>Actions such as those noted above can have a tremendous positive impact upon those Indian Nationals seeking United States Immigration benefits as the ability to process such travel documents at any Post in India generally results in a great deal more convenience compared to the policy of keeping Consular jurisdictions mutually exclusive.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>As mentioned previously on this blog, the United States dollar is weakening relative to other currencies as other economies around the world strengthen. In a <a title="recent report" href="http://in.reuters.com/article/idINSGE6A904K20101110" target="_blank">recent report</a> from Reuters in India:</p>
<blockquote><p><strong><em><span id="articleText">Foreign funds have so far in 2010 bought shares worth a record $28.3 billion, in addition to last year&#8217;s $17.5 billion. The rupee has gained 5 percent so far this year.</span></em></strong></p></blockquote>
<p><span>In terms of international trade, the announcement of a declining dollar could be viewed negatively. However, a comparatively weak United States dollar could turn out to be a boon for those Indian nationals interested in making a qualified investment in the USA while also accruing the benefit of United States Lawful Permanent Residence. </span></p>
<p><span>The EB-5 visa program was designed to provide a travel document and Lawful Permanent Residence to those who make an investment in the USA which meets the eligibility criteria set forth by American Immigration authorities such as the United States Citizenship and Immigration Service (USCIS), Department of Homeland Security, and the Department of State. Those interested in obtaining an EB-5 visa should note that the investment in the United States must be substantial and should exceed at least five hundred thousand United States dollars ($500,000), or one million dollars (1,000,000) if the investment is not a &#8220;targeted&#8221; investment. Lawful Permanent Resident (LPR) status means that the Indian national in said status has the right to reside and work in the United States permanently. LPR status is highly sought after by those in countries outside of the United States since the benefit is substantial, but immigration law may preclude many visa seekers from obtaining a travel document that confers Lawful Permanent Residence (also referred to as &#8220;Green Card&#8221; status).<br />
</span></p>
<p><span>Some individuals have posed the question: &#8220;Does the United States allow Citizenship by investment?&#8221; The simple answer is: no. However, the <a title="EB-5 visa" href="http://integrity-legal.com/legal-blog/us-visa-immigration/eb-5-visa-thailand-why-strong-baht-is-a-boon-to-prospective-american-immigrant-investors/" target="_blank">EB-5 visa</a> could be viewed as a means of setting oneself on the &#8220;path to citizenship&#8221; by investment. This is due to the fact that an <a title="EB5 visa" href="http://integrity-legal.com/legal-blog/us-embassy-indonesia/eb-5-visa-indonesia-how-quantitative-easing-can-be-beneficial-to-prospective-american-immigrant-investors/" target="_blank">EB5 visa</a> holder, who meets the legal criteria, may be able to apply for <a title="naturalization" href="http://integrity-legal.com/legal-blog/uscis/information-regarding-newly-updated-naturalization-certificate/" target="_blank">naturalization</a> to US Citizenship after remaining in the United States for a statutorily prescribed period of time in lawful permanent resident status. </span></p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Those American Citizens with Indian husbands or wives often research issues surrounding the US K-3 marriage visa category in an effort to make informed decisions about American travel documentation. Although the term &#8220;K-3 visa&#8221; has become a common buzzword used as a colloquial synonym for <a title="US Marriage Visa" href="http://www.integrity-legal.com/marriage-in-thailand.html" target="_blank">US Marriage Visa</a> on the World Wide Web, the K-3 category was not always the widely utilized travel document for Indian-American couples reuniting in the United States as the Immigrant visa categories often referred to as CR-1 and/or IR-1 visas were once the only travel documents available to the spouses of American Citizens wishing to take up residence in the USA (note: the IR-1 visa category predates the CR-1 visa category as conditional lawful permanent residence status has not always been imposed upon foreign spouses of US Citizens married less than 2 years).</p>
<p>There was a rather significant backlog of Immigrant visa petitions at the agency now commonly referred to as the United States Citizenship and Immigration Service (USCIS) when the <a title="K3 visa" href="http://www.integrity-legal.com/us-visa/visa-denial.html" target="_blank">K3 visa</a> category was created by Congressional legislation sometimes called the &#8220;Life Act&#8221; which was signed and executed by President William Jefferson Clinton prior to leaving office toward the end of his term (the K-4 visa, similar to the K2 derivative visa attached to the <a title="K1 visa" href="http://www.integrity-legal.com/us-visa/k1-visa-thailand.html" target="_blank">K1 visa</a>, was a derivative visa category also created by the &#8220;Life Act&#8221; to be utilized by the children of an Indian K-3 spouse).</p>
<p>Currently, the United States Citizenship and Immigration Service does not have the backlog that it once had of Immigrant spousal visa petitions. As a result, the K-3&#8242;s utility has been increasingly marginalized as the estimated <a title="processing time" href="http://integrity-legal.com/legal-blog/us-visa-immigration/uscis-processing-times-california-service-center-nebraska-service-center-vermont-service-center-texas-service-center/" target="_blank">processing time</a> for <a title="CR-1 visa" href="http://www.integrity-legal.com/us-visa/immigrant-visa-process.html" target="_blank">CR-1 visa</a> petitions and <a title="IR-1 visa" href="http://www.integrity-legal.com/us-visa/immigrant-spouse-visa.html" target="_blank">IR-1 visa</a> petitions has decreased. Relatively recently, the American State Department&#8217;s <a title="National Visa Center" href="http://integrity-legal.com/legal-blog/us-visa-immigration/us-visa-process-uscis-service-center-estimated-processing-times/" target="_blank">National Visa Center</a> (NVC) promulgated the policy that K-3 visa applications would be administratively closed if and/or when the adjudicated immigrant visa petition arrives at NVC before or with the supplemental K-3 visa petition. This policy has likely lead to some Indian-American married couples to seek Immigrant visa benefits rather than K-3 visa benefits as &#8220;administrative closure&#8221; precluded further processing of the K-3 visa petition and application.</p>
